Deepening Our Practice: The 16 Exercises of Mindful Breathing

Dear Friends, At the Breathing Heart Sangha, we often return to the breath as our primary anchor. While we are all familiar with the foundational practice of returning to the present moment, our tradition offers a profound and comprehensive map for this journey: the Anapanasati Sutta, or the Discourse on the Full Awareness of Breathing […]

Sangha Together Virtually

For the past several COVID-affected months, we have been meeting virtually via videoconference. The “we” includes members of the Breathing Heart Sangha and the Mindful Breath Sangha, based in the Athens, Georgia area. This combination of Sanghas, along with people from other areas around the country and world, have added much meaning to our gatherings.
